Method 1: Kitchener Stitch Seam (Invisible Horizontal) Kitchener stitch is a live cast-off seaming method that creates a new row of knitting between your two edges, so it just looks like another regular pattern row. If you want something to look perfectly seamless, this stitch will do it, without even a ridge on the fabric's wrong side.

To join two pieces together, thread a darning needle with the same yarn used to make the garment. Place the edges of the garment side by side with the right sides (the sides that people will see) FACING OUT. Stitch up the sides as shown, alternating from side to side. A good shoulder seam should be strong while still looking seamless. The most important thing is working into the stitch under the bind off. This will guarantee a strong seam. If you are always working under the skinny part of the V, you will be creating an uninterrupted line of stitches. Shoulder Graft
